Falken Azenis RT615K+The Azenis RT615K+ is a further evolution of Falken Tire's championship-winning Extreme Performance Summer tire, the Azenis RT615K. Developed for drivers of muscle cars, sports cars, street rods and performance sedans who want ultimate grip in warm, dry and wet conditions, the Azenis RT615K+ is not intended to be serviced, stored nor driven in near- or below-freezing temperatures, through snow or on ice.

Utilizing the proven internal construction and motorsports-inspired asymmetric tread pattern as its predecessor, the Azenis RT615K+ features Falken's latest Extreme Summer Performance-targeted compound. The updated compound is designed to further satisfy the increased performance expectations of competitive drivers through additional dry grip. The Massive Sport Side Shoulder Blocks deliver extreme levels of lateral traction through turns, and the solid center rib effectively puts the power to the ground by providing constant contact with the road. Inboard circumferential grooves and notched tread blocks help evacuate water from the contact patch, improving wet traction and hydroplaning resistance.

Internal construction of the Azenis RT615K+ includes a high-tension casing to help increase handling response and high-speed stability. Twin, high-tensile steel belts are reinforced by a spirally-wrapped nylon Joint-less Cap Ply to promote even wear and durability.

Extreme Performance Summer tires exposed to temperatures of 20 degrees F (-7 degrees C) or lower must be permitted to gradually return to temperatures of at least 40 degrees F (5 degrees C) for at least 24 hours before they are flexed in any manner, such as by adjusting inflation pressures, mounting them on wheels, or using them to support, roll or drive a vehicle.

Note: Flexing of the specialized rubber compounds used in Extreme Performance Summer tires during cold-weather use can result in irreversible compound cracking. While compound cracking is not a warrantable condition because it occurs as the result of improper use or storage, tires exhibiting compound cracking must be replaced.

Falken Azenis RT615K+ Reviews

Customers say the tire delivers exceptional dry traction and precise handling, excelling in autocross and track environments with predictable grip and responsive steering. Wet performance is manageable in light rain but requires caution in heavy downpours due to hydroplaning risks, especially as tread wears. Treadwear is praised for a 200TW tire, offering respectable longevity through multiple heat cycles, though aggressive use accelerates wear. Ideal for drivers prioritizing track-ready performance and durability over all-weather versatility.

...The last set lasted me 2 summers and about 16-20,000 mi of daily spirited and abusive driving... The second summer I could definitely tell a slight loss in grip from the rubber hardening slightly but they still performed great. I used them down to 1/32nd and probably could have gone further...

Absolutely loved these tires so much that i just got a new set. The last set lasted me 2 summers and about 16-20,000 mi of daily spirited and abusive driving. I never used them on track or autocross only street driving mostly back roads during my 60 mi round trip commute to and from work. The second summer I could definitely tell a slight loss in grip from the rubber hardening slightly but they still performed great. I used them down to 1/32nd and probably could have gone further. If you're looking for a CHEAP high performance street tire I highly recommend these, you won't be disappointed.
